price

Вычислите цену за инструмент акции с VannaVolga калькулятор цен

Описание

пример

[Price,PriceResult] = price(inpPricer,inpInstrument) вычисляет инструментальную цену и связанную информацию о ценах на основе объекта inpPricer оценки и инструментальный объект inpInstrument.

пример

[Price,PriceResult] = price(___,inpSensitivity) добавляет дополнительный аргумент, чтобы задать чувствительность.

Примеры

TBD

Входные параметры

свернуть все

Объект Pricer в виде скалярного VannaVolga объект калькулятора цен. Использование finpricer создать VannaVolga объект калькулятора цен.

Типы данных: object

Объект Instrument в виде скаляра или вектора из Vanilla, Barrier, DoubleBarrier, Touch, или DoubleTouch инструментальные объекты. Использование fininstrument создать Vanilla, Barrier, DoubleBarrier, Touch, или DoubleTouchинструментальные объекты.

Типы данных: object

(Необязательно) Список чувствительности, чтобы вычислить в виде NOUT- 1 или 1- NOUT массив ячеек из символьных векторов или массив строк с поддерживаемыми значениями.

inpSensitivity = {'All'} или inpSensitivity = ["All"] указывает, что выходом является 'Delta'\Gamma, 'Vega'\lambda\rho, 'Theta', и 'Price'. Это совпадает с определением inpSensitivity включать каждую чувствительность.

Пример: inpSensitivity = {'delta','gamma','vega','rho','lambda','theta','price'}

Поддерживаемая чувствительность зависит от inpInstrument.

inpInstrumentПоддерживаемая чувствительность
Vanilla, 'delta','gamma','vega','rho','lambda','theta','price'
Barrier'delta','gamma','vega','rho','lambda','theta','price'
DoubleBarrier'delta','gamma','vega','rho','lambda','theta','price'
Touch'delta','gamma','vega','rho','lambda','theta','price'
DoubleTouch'delta','gamma','vega','rho','lambda','theta','price'

Типы данных: string | cell

Выходные аргументы

свернуть все

Инструментальная цена, возвращенная как числовое.

Ценовой результат, возвращенный как PriceResult объект. Объект имеет следующие поля:

  • PriceResult.Results — Таблица результатов, которая включает чувствительность (если вы задаете inpSensitivity)

  • PriceResult.PricerData — Структура для данных о калькуляторе цен

  • PriceResult.PricerData.Overhedge TBD

Введенный в R2020b